#39d234 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#39d234 is composed of 22.4% red, 82.4%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 75.2%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 118.1 degrees, a saturation of 63.7% and a lightness of 51.4%. #39d234 color hex could be obtained by blending #72ff68 with #00a500.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

● #39d234 color description : Strong lime green.
#39d234 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#39d234 has RGB values of R:57, G:210,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0, Y:0.75,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 3789364.
